Among silver and copper, which one is a better conductor and why?

  1. The two basic parameters to depict the better conductor among silver and copper are the “presence of free electrons” and the “resistivity”.
  2. The presence of free electrons ensures that sufficient or abundant free electrons are present for the flow of current.
  3. Resistivity depicts how difficult is it for the free electrons to move through a conductor to produce an electric current.
  4. From pure coherent logic, a better conductor must have abundant free electrons and the least resistivity.
  5. Silver has more free electrons as compared to copper.
  6. The resistivity of silver is "1.59×10-8Ωm"and the resistivity of copper is "1.68×10-8Ωm"
  7. Presence of abundant free electrons and the least resistivity in the case of silver makes it a better conductor as compared to copper.

Hence, silver is a better conductor than copper.
